About Annie Petit-Homme
Annie Petit-Homme, APRN is a board-certified nurse practitioner with a passion for oncology. After graduating from the University of Florida with a Bachelor of Science in Nursing in 2016, she began working as an oncology registered nurse at AdventHealth Hospital. She then obtained her Master of Science in Nursing from the University of South Florida in 2021 to continue to pursue her passion for caring for others in oncology. Annie loves the complex field of oncology and looks forward to providing optimum care for her patients.
